Nick Reiner has been charged with murdering his parents
The District office in Los Angeles on Tuesday charged Nick Reiner, the son of movie director and actor Rob Reiner, and his wife, photographer Michele Singer Reiner, with two counts of first-degree murder in the brutal deaths of his parents, said Nathan Hochman, the Los Angeles District attorney.
A jury would decide whether Nick, who is 32, would remain in prison for the rest of his life or face the death penalty, Hochman said during a news conference in Los Angeles. He would also have to be medically cleared before being transferred to the county jail.
Nick is being held on $4 million bond after police arrested him near the University of Southern California. He is charged with the stabbing death of murders of his parents in their bedroom at their Brentwood home in Los Angeles.
Rob Reiner,78, and Michele Singer Reiner,68, were found dead on Sunday. They were repeatedly stabbed to death. Their daughter, Romy, discovered their bodies on December 14.
The Los Angeles Fire Department was called to the Reiner home around 3:30 p.m. local time on the 14th to provide medical aid. Police would not say if they found a knife used to kill them.
It was the second horrific stabbing in December, in which a son was accused of murdering his father.
Michah Sykes, 31, appeared before Los Angeles Superior Court Judge on December 11, charged with the murder of Jubilant Sykes, 71, at the family’s Santa Monica home on Monday, December 8. Jubilant Sykes was a Grammy-nominated opera singer.
Micah Sykes was ordered held without bond following his father’s murder. Micah and Nick have some aspects in common. Both were homeless for periods, and they both suffered from mental illness.
Jubilant died from multiple stab wounds following a domestic argument. Relatives, who attended the hearing, argued for no bail, citing the suspect’s apparent schizophrenia diagnosis, for which he was allegedly not taking medication.
Jubilant, a baritone, was nominated for a Grammy for his performance in a 2009 recording of Leonard Bernstein’s Mass and went on to perform at leading venues such as the Metropolitan Opera, Carnegie Hall, and the Kennedy Center.
He shares three sons with his wife, Cecelia. She witnessed her husband’s murder.
Jubilant also collaborated with a wide range of prominent artists, including Julie Andrews, Josh Groban, Carlos Santana, and Brian Wilson of The Beach Boys.
Michele Singer first met Rob Reiner while he was directing “When Harry Met Sally.” They later married in 1989. Rob and Michele had two sons together: Jake, Nick. Reiner’s daughter, Romy, was adopted by Penny Marshall, his first wife.
Nick has previously spoken out about his struggles with addiction and homelessness, beginning in his teens. Reiner’s middle child told PEOPLE in 2016 that he cycled in and out of rehab beginning around age 15. As his addiction escalated, Nick said he drifted farther from home and spent significant stretches homeless in multiple states.
The story behind his and his father’s 2015 film together, “Being Charlie,” was partly inspired by Nick’s younger years. Father and son wrote the film together.
Rob was the director of several iconic films, including “This Is Spinal Tap” (1984), “Stand By Me,” “The Princess Bride”(1987), “A Few Good Men” (1992), and “Misery.” He has a podcast about naming the persons who killed President John F. Kennedy with Soledad O’Brien. He was best known as Mike, the “Meathead” Stivic in the popular sitcom “All in the Family.”
Rob was the son of legendary comedian Carl Reiner, who died June 29, 2020
